Canon support code 2110 (paper settings mismatch)

Support code 2110 means the paper size or type set for the tray on the printer does not match what the print job asked for. The printer registers the paper loaded in each tray; when the driver sends a job specifying different paper it pauses and asks whether to continue, replace the paper, or cancel. It is a safety check rather than a fault.

What causes it

  • Loading a new paper size or type without updating the printer's paper information
  • Print driver set to Letter while the printer is set to A4, or vice versa
  • Photo paper loaded in the cassette where the printer expects plain paper
  • A job sent from a phone app with a default paper size different from the tray
  • Paper information registration set to a strict mode

How to fix it, in order

Work down the list and stop when the printer recovers. The steps are ordered from most likely and least invasive to last resort.

  1. Read the message on the printer

    The screen shows the paper the tray is registered for and what the job requested. This tells you which side to change.

  2. Choose an action on the printer

    Select Print with the loaded paper to continue, Replace the paper to load the correct type and update the registration, or Cancel to stop the job.

  3. Update the tray's paper information

    Each time you load a tray the printer asks you to confirm the size and type. Set this correctly, or go to Setup, Feed settings, Paper information and set it manually.

  4. Match the driver settings

    In the print dialog on the computer or phone, set the paper size and media type to match what is in the tray. Pay attention to Letter versus A4, which is a frequent cause in mixed environments.

  5. Relax the mismatch detection

    If the prompt is annoying, go to Setup, Feed settings, Detect paper setting mismatch and turn it off. The printer will then print with whatever is loaded, so make sure sizes are genuinely compatible.

Frequently asked questions

How do I stop Canon error 2110 appearing every time?

Turn off Detect paper setting mismatch in the printer's Feed settings, or keep the tray registration and the driver settings in sync.

Does 2110 mean the wrong paper is loaded?

Not necessarily. It means the printer was told one thing and the job asked for another. If the paper in the tray suits the job, choose Print with the loaded paper.

Why does printing from my iPhone cause 2110?

AirPrint and the Canon app send a paper size based on the phone's region. Set the tray registration to match, or change the size in the app's print options.
